Dining
We dined at the La Mar Salada as part of the Royal benefits, it was terrible, the rice burnt and my son's steak was served rare (he wanted medium), it was sent back and recooked, but his experience and appetite had gone as it just wasn't edible, it returned looking like it had been smashed by a tenderiser and recooked, same piece of meet, awful.
We booked the Rodizio buffet, wasn't expecting much, but the experience was awful, the starters were stone cold and the meats (except the Turkey) were inedible, we shared our concerns politely with the manager who could see how poor the standard was, he tried to correct the situation, offering us chips (cold) and rice (luke warm), essentially none of the family ate again that night. Room
Made two requests via the Royal Level concierge service, the day after we arrived to share that the hot tub on the patio of our room was dangerous and that it had injured me, nobody from maintenance ever arrived to fix the problem (photo included of my injury and the hot tub) meaning that we couldnt use the tub with our children for the vast majority of the holiday.
TV, also reported at the same time, no TV channels of any description, just radio - no response from maintenance.
The Hotel Services
The Royal Level pool is dangerous, it has a number of tiles missing and injured my child's foot (photo), there are sharp edges and it's going to injure someone else more severely.
Padel courts, closed for days, I accepted the weather had not helped, but there is no urgency to have these repaired, meaning they couldn't be used for the remainder of the holiday. Ridiculous.
Spa - steam room closed and not available at any point, for the whole holiday.
Golf SIM - my children are both members of Golf Clubs with handicaps at a country club in England, it's ridiculous to judge someone on age, rather than ability, my children would compete against any adult who has never played golf before but we we're not allowed to use the SIM, causing much distress and upset, so we went to the SIM bar in the town where the kids were welcomed, with open arms.
The general cleanliness of the hotel is also very poor and not to the standards we expect of Barcelo. The Royal pool area is filthy, cups, empty food carton and towels everywhere. Provide more bins and people will use them."
